Boards often go through multiple iterations (Rev A, Rev 1.0, Rev 2.0). Ensure the revision flag in your boardview software matches the revision printed on the physical fiberglass to prevent pin misalignments during testing.

The text "94V-0" stamped on a PCB is not a model number; it is a UL 94 flammability rating . It certifies that the board’s fiberglass-reinforced epoxy material will self-extinguish within 10 seconds when subjected to a vertical flame test, preventing the propagation of fire in industrial and consumer installations.
